关注分享主机优惠活动
国内外VPS云服务器

如何在Ubuntu上使用Pygame开发益智游戏(ubuntu使用Python编程)

要在 Ubuntu 上使用 Pygame 开发益智游戏,需要按照以下步骤操作:

安装 Pygame:

首先,确保您的 Ubuntu 系统上安装了 Python。 接下来,使用 pip 命令安装 Pygame 模块。 在终端中输入以下命令:

pip install pygame

创建游戏窗口

Python 脚本必须首先导入并初始化 Pygame 模块。 接下来,创建一个窗口来显示游戏屏幕。 示例:

导入 pygame

# 初始化 Pygame
pygame.init()

# 设置窗口大小
 screen_width = 800
screen_height = 600

# 创建窗口
screen = pygame.display.set_mode((screen_width, screen_height))

# 设置窗口标题mas
pygame 。    展示et_caption("益智游戏")

游戏元素设计

设计益智游戏时,您可能需要创建各种图形元素,例如背景、对象和谜题。 您可以使用 Pygame 的绘图功能来实现这些元素。 例如,绘制一个矩形:

# 绘制一个矩形
rect = pygame.   矩形(100100200) , 100)
pygame.draw.rect(screen, (255, 0, 0), rect)

添加交互角色

为了允许玩家与您的游戏进行交互,您需要监听玩家输入事件并根据这些事件更新游戏状态。 例如,当玩家点击特定区域时,会触发以下事件:

for 事件 pygame.event.get():
 if 事件。  类型 == pygame.QUIT :
 pygame.quit()
 sys.exit()
 埃利夫事件。  类型 == pygame.MOUSEBUTTONDOWN:
 x, y = pygame.mouse.get_pos()
 # 这里处理鼠标点击事件

实现游戏逻辑

这是一个核心益智游戏开发的一部分。 根据游戏类型和规则,需要实现相应的逻辑。 例如,对于拼图游戏,您可能需要实现一种算法来确定拼图是否完整。
6.测试和调试:

游戏的基本框架完成后,需要进行大量的测试和调试工作,以确保游戏的稳定性。游戏必须被执行。 容易玩。
7.优化和改进:

根据测试结果,可能需要优化和改进游戏,包括添加音效和改进界面设计。

以上是在Ubuntu上使用Pygame开发益智游戏的基本步骤。 请注意,这只是一个高级框架,您的具体实现将根据游戏的设计和需求而有所不同。

未经允许不得转载:主机频道 » 如何在Ubuntu上使用Pygame开发益智游戏(ubuntu使用Python编程)

评论 抢沙发

评论前必须登录!